Christina Pultrone is an accomplished professional with extensive experience in knowledge management, research, and public affairs. Currently serving as a Knowledge Manager in the Public Affairs Office of the Illinois National Guard, Christina oversees the management of the organization’s website and mobile applications. As a Senior Analyst for Prospect Research at Oberlin College, Christina conducts thorough research on leadership gift prospects to support fundraising initiatives. Previous roles include Publications Specialist for the U.S. Army, where Christina provided administrative support and document management, and a Science Librarian at NASA Glenn Research Center, where in-depth research services were offered to support aerospace personnel. Christina holds a Master’s degree in Library and Information Science from Kent State University and is currently pursuing a Front-End Web Developer course at the University of Illinois Springfield.
